Abstract

Since US death records contain more then 15 million decedents, it is possible to verify the month-of-birth pattern for the same causes of death that were analysed in the second chapter on the basis of the Austrian data. In general, the month-of-birth patterns for Austria are confirmed. However, those causes of death that were of borderline significance or insignificant in the Austrian study are now significant in the US data set (e.g. lung cancer, diabetes mellitus).
